For Q1 FY2026 ended March 31, 2026, NextNav Inc. reported revenue of $995,000, a 35.3% decrease year-over-year. Net loss was $10.6 million, improving 81.9% from the prior year. Operating loss was $19.3 million, worsening 13.8%. Diluted EPS was -$0.12, a 73.3% improvement. Cash stood at $30.6 million, equity was negative $90.0 million, and long-term debt was $267.2 million.

NextNav provides positioning, navigation, and timing (PNT) solutions in the United States. The company offers Pinnacle, an accurate altitude service for public safety applications, including enhanced 911 for Verizon and national cellular network providers
TerraPoiNT, a 3D PNT system, provides positioning, navigation, and timing services provided by GPS through a land-based GPS satellite constellation. The company serves Wi-Fi, telecom, public safety, location apps, and critical infrastructure industries. Founded in 2007, the company is headquartered in Reston, Virginia.
